Moderator Emeritus mammaP Posted December 11, 2013 Moderator Emeritus Share Posted December 11, 2013 Hi PD, I'm sorry you are in this position, I also think it is reckless and cruel to refuse a prescription because you don't have the money for the consult! It might be worth a try asking the pharmaceutical company to see if you can get samples. Our NHS has it's problems but no one has to pay to see a doctor! It would be best if you can get hold of some fluoxetine, and reinstate a very small amount. If you could get hold of just a months supply it could last 3-4 months at a reduced dose. There are things you can do to lessen some of the agonies of withdrawal but no cures unfortunately. It will get better, I know it doesn't seem like it now but it will., in time you will have your life back, in the meantime take care of yourself the best way you can. Nutritious food, water, gentle walks outside if you can, and sleep when you are able. We recommend fish oil and magnesium supplements only as some can make things worse. Many of us have spent hundreds of $ on supplements that just clutter up the cupboards, so don't think you need to buy those! Others will be along to offer their suggestions also. Administrator Altostrata Posted December 11, 2013 Administrator Share Posted December 11, 2013 Welcome, PD. Your doctor was negligent in letting you go without a prescription. I suggest you phone her office immediately and tell her you are having severe withdrawal from Prozac, and you need a prescription ASAP. You can get a prescription from any doctor. If necessary, go to your community health clinic for one. Please reinstate at least 20mg Prozac as soon as possible to forestall the possibility of prolonged withdrawal syndrome.
